59 minutes ago, Klem said:

Hi!

You need to read another chip (25Q32). Correct dump size for E531 it is 4MB (4 096KB).

Thank you, but I cannot find any 25Q chip on my motherboard.

There are only two chips that should contain bios CFEON EN25QH64, and CFEON EN25QH32.

From which I should read the bios?

Maybe I have bad programmer settings and it didnt read whole bios. Because auto-detect didnt work ,so I have to choose one chip manually, but CFEON not found in menu.

On 3/4/2023 at 6:44 PM, DakotaFred said:

Because auto-detect didnt work ,so I have to choose one chip manually, but CFEON not found in menu.

If you use programmer CH341A, then try to use software AsProgrammer_1.4.1 :

https://files.fm/u/zkjtm3kds

 

Choice chip: IC -> SPI -> EON -> EN25QH32
